Topics Covered

  1. 1. Introduction to Quantum Computing: Learners will explore the basic principles of quantum mechanics, qubits, and quantum gates, providing a foundational understanding of quantum computing. They will gain the practical skill of simulating simple quantum circuits using Python.
  2. 2. Variational Quantum Algorithms Fundamentals: This module covers the basics of variational algorithms, including the variational principle and the role of quantum circuits in optimization problems. Learners will develop skills in implementing basic variational algorithms on quantum simulators.
  3. 3. Quantum Circuit Design and Optimization: Focusing on practical aspects of designing and optimizing quantum circuits, learners will study techniques for reducing circuit depth and improving gate fidelity. They will also practice optimizing variational algorithms for specific problems.
  4. 4. Quantum Machine Learning Basics: This module introduces learners to the intersection of quantum computing and machine learning, covering key concepts and algorithms like quantum support vector machines and quantum neural networks. Practical skills include implementing basic quantum machine learning models.
  5. 5. Advanced Variational Quantum Algorithms: Progressing to more complex variational algorithms such as the Quantum Approximate Optimization Algorithm (QAOA) and Variational Quantum Eigensolver (VQE), learners will delve into optimizing these algorithms for specific applications. They will gain the ability to customize and optimize variational algorithms for their own projects.
  6. 6. Quantum Algorithm Simulation: Learners will use quantum simulators to model and analyze various quantum algorithms, including variational algorithms. Practical skills include selecting appropriate simulators, setting up simulations, and interpreting results.
  7. 7. Quantum Device Programming: This module covers the practical aspects of programming quantum devices, including understanding the constraints and limitations of current quantum hardware. Learners will gain experience in translating variational algorithms into code for real quantum devices.
  8. 8. Real-world Application Case Studies: Through case studies, learners will apply their knowledge of variational quantum algorithms to real-world problems, such as optimization and machine learning. They will develop the ability to choose and tailor algorithms for specific applications and evaluate their performance.
  9. 9. Advanced Topics in Variational Algorithms: This module explores advanced topics including quantum error correction, fault-tolerant quantum computing, and hybrid classical-quantum algorithms. Learners will gain a deeper understanding of how to mitigate errors and scale up variational algorithms.
  10. 10. Capstone Project: Learners will work on a comprehensive project applying their knowledge to develop and implement a variational quantum algorithm for a real-world problem. They will demonstrate their ability to design, optimize, and evaluate quantum algorithms in a practical setting.
